>As you may have heard by now, I've accepted the role of Editor-in-Chief of the UniversalThread Magazine (www.utmag.com). This free magazine hasn't released an issue since March of 2007. The previous Editor, Martín Salías, approached me quite some time ago but we only recently made it official. It's only coincidence that this happened just shortly after the announcement of FoxRockX (www.foxrockx.com).
>
>There is still a lot of life in FoxPro and the community. The magazine had regular contributions from many well-known developers and interviewed industry legends like Doug Hennig and Rick Strahl. I hope to continue that tradition. To do that, I hope to re-establish relationships with regular columnists. Those of you who have done regular columns for UTMag before are encouraged to continue them! I'm also making a call to the community for columnists and/or articles. We don't pay for articles, but getting published is good for your career and/or reputation.
